What are Nashville's Open Container Laws?

Nashville's open container laws, like many other cities, primarily focus on prohibiting the public consumption of alcohol outside designated areas. This means you can't stroll down Broadway with a beer in hand, enjoying the music and atmosphere as you go. The specifics, however, can be nuanced and depend on your location.

Key Restrictions:

  • Public Consumption: Generally, drinking alcohol in public spaces like sidewalks, streets, and parks is illegal. This includes open containers of any alcoholic beverage, even if sealed.
  • Designated Areas: Certain areas, particularly within officially permitted entertainment districts, may have exceptions. These districts often allow open containers within specific boundaries, usually clearly marked. Always check the signage and local regulations for specific details.
  • Vehicles: Drinking and having open containers in vehicles are strictly prohibited, even if parked. This is a serious offense with significant consequences.
  • Private Property: While generally permitted on private property (like a bar's patio), it is still crucial to be aware of the establishment's rules and regulations. Always check with the venue before consuming alcohol outside.

Where is it LEGAL to have an open container?

The legality of open containers often hinges on location. While public consumption is generally prohibited, there are some exceptions:

  • Bars and Restaurants: Drinking alcohol is perfectly legal within licensed establishments. Enjoy your drinks responsibly inside or on designated patios.
  • Designated Entertainment Districts: Specific areas within Nashville are designated as open container zones. These areas typically have clear signage indicating the permitted boundaries. Be sure to stay within these marked zones.
  • Private Property with Permission: If you're on private property (e.g., a friend's backyard) and have permission, open containers are generally acceptable. But be mindful of local noise ordinances and responsible consumption.
